  2. Mr. Wonderful is a musical with a book by Joseph Stein and Will Glickman, and music and lyrics by Jerry Bock, Larry Holofcener, and George David Weiss. Written specifically to showcase the talents of Sammy Davis Jr. , the thin plot, focusing on entertainer Charlie Welch's show business struggles, primarily served as a springboard for ...

  6. Mr. Wonderful" is a popular song, written in 1955 written by Jerry Bock, George David Weiss, and Larry Holofcener, as the title song of a Broadway musical starring Sammy Davis Jr. The song was introduced in the musical by Olga James.

  7. In late January 1956, Sammy Davis, Jr. embarked on the next chapter of his career, starting rehearsals for his starring role in Mr. Wonderful, a Broadway musical. The musical was an original, written specifically as a vehicle for Sammy to show off his myriad talents on the Great White Way.
